Hindu mythology has always held peacock in great reverence. It has always depicted positive qualities such as benevolence, patience, kindness, compassion, and knowledge along with being a symbol of eternal beauty admired and revered by even the Gods. It is believed that Peacock was awarded its vibrant and colourful appearance as a result of some